This maybe true. In general, SCSI has the capability to lock the door
or to ignore hard-coded unmount/eject commands until this will be released by the software.
You may control this via the SCSI Mode Select parameter list. However, the software
handles this for you automatically.
Fo be able to eject the media you must unmount it from the device before you
should be able to press the eject button. It would not be good for any software
if you would be able to eject during a read/write process.
